Fresh Strawberry Pie

To experience the full flavor of fresh berries, use the sweetest, ripest strawberries you can find and serve the pie within four hours of preparing it. If your strawberries are less than perfectly sweet, you may want to add a bit of sweetener to the blended filling mixture. The optional psyllium is available at health food stores and is used to help the pie filling hold together. Instead of a date-nut crust, you may substitute a graham or cookie-crumb crust, or a regular prebaked pie shell.

Chickpea & Eggplant Kibbe

Kibbe is a traditional Lebanese dish made with bulgur and ground meat. In this version, chickpeas and eggplant replace the meat. The result is a hearty, one-dish meal that can be assembled ahead of time and baked half an hour before serving. I serve this with a sesame sauce made by thinning hummus with a little soymilk.

Basil Pesto

Since basil leaves turn brown when they come in prolonged contact with air, spread a thin layer of olive oil on top of the pesto before refrigerating in a tightly sealed container. If you omit the soy parmesan, you may want to add a little more salt.
